The Bramble Knights
Once the Bramble Knights were great Heroes of Crystalia. The statues erected in their honor were timeless memorials to the brave warriors who defended the kingdom and Fae Wood with their lives.
When The Forgotten King sought to challenge the rightful rule of Crystalia, the Bramble Knights sworn to him marched under his banner. Bitter civil war raged throughout the realm. Only when the elves of the Fae Wood joined the fight were the Forgotten King’s forces finally stopped.
As punishment for their treachery the once gallant Bramble Knights shared The Forgotten King’s fate. Cursed by their own treasonous lord they were transformed into chimera. No longer human, nor beast, they became monsters and were banished to the Lordship Ruins. Centuries later they still dwell within its crumbled halls, nurturing old hates, and plotting their re-emergence under the Dark Consul’s banner.
At the edge of the Fae Wood, there lies the border to the Glauerdoom Moor. This is a particularly dread location, and the Cursed Knights of the Moorlands make this their home. Having long forsaken their duty to The Forgotten King, these twisted chimera have fallen under the thrall of Nightsong the Eternal. Equally as cruel as they are deathless.
Beyond the markers and borders of the Lordship Ruins the curse even extended to his scouts and assassins. These elite knights, without a mission, cursed to walk as chimera, pillage and rain havoc as bandits. The dread effort to find purpose amidst the carnage is all that binds their fleeting sanity to this world.

Grobbits
The executioners are infamous foes to all the people of Crystalia. Even before the curse that turned The Forgotten King and his followers into bestial chimera, the Bramble Knight Executioners were terrifying figures. With powerful sweeps of their axes, they performed the grim duty with unsettling satisfaction. Now, they employ their axes with unabandoned cruelty and cleave through Heroes with wicked delight.
Versions of these terrible enemies exist as part of both Bandit and Cursed Knight warbands. Deathlords have lost all trace of their former human selves. As centuries have passed, the cursed magic which keeps them alive has degraded their minds and sharpened their appetite for cruelty. This otherness radiates from them in waves of despair, shattering foes' resolve and even robbing the desire to flee as the Deathlord mercilessly cuts through their ranks.
Some Grobbits have escaped to the Dragonback Peaks, seeking shelter in the snaking paths and forgotten caverns found there. Alone and bitter, their minds have begun to change just like their bodies. Over the years their humanity has slipped away, leaving them as bestial and feral within as they are on the outside.
Frog Knights
Mounted on battle-hardened Squawks, Frog Knights attempt to hold true to their former chivalrous past. With great leaps they manoeuvre through the battle to engage a worthy foe in single combat. Win or lose, such a duel is their highest honor.
This is an area where they depart in difference from their Cursed and Bandit brethren. The Cursed Skull Riders are shadowy and secretive, slinking at the back of their lines until the right moment comes to snatch victory. Skull Squawk knights are a secretive bunch. In fact, there are none who can recall ever seeing one outside of their armor or sharing a single word with another. This shadowy aloofness, combined with Skull Squawk's uncanny supernatural abilities lead many to wonder if they are truly within the realm of the living at all.
The Marauders are fearsome outriders, caring little for their chivalric roots and more about the booty they can collect. The Bramble Knight cavalry who aided in the shadow are against the forces of Crystalia became the fearsome Marauder Squawks when their bitter lord cursed all of his forces. Unlike other knights who were bound by chivalry and honor, these marauders were masters of thieving, spying, and dirty fighting tactics.
Billmen
Though not full fledged knights, the Billmen made up the majority of the Forgotten Kings personal guard. Nonetheless, they were held in high esteem for their courage and skill at arms. Exemplary service within the Billmen could elevate one to the rank of Bramble Knight.
During the Forgotten King’s uprising, Billmen made up the primary bulk of his forces. Most of these stalwart warriors marched off to battle not knowing of their master’s treason. They dutifully fought in the war believing their cause was just and in the service of the Goddess.
For this reason the Billmen are often seen as the most tragic of figures, unwittingly serving a dark master and doomed to share his fate. The Cursed Militia and Bandits feel the full weight of the betrayal of throwing in their lot with The Forgotten King. The Cursed Militia found new purpose in the bosom of Nightsong's fledgling empire, while the Bandits continue to steal everything not nailed down to fill that gaping hole in their hearts left from being cursed so.
